Governor Kemp and Hyundai Motor Group announce $5.54 billion investment into Electric Vehicle facility

(41NBC/WMGT) — Governor Brian Kemp and members from the Hyundai Motor Group announced Friday that they would be opening it’s first fully dedicated electric vehicle and battery manufacturing facility in Georgia. Hyundai will be investing $5.54 billion in opening the U.S. smart factory at the Bryan County Megasite. Other suppliers are expected to invest $1 billion into the project, bringing…

Bus manufacturer Blue Bird, lays off 115 at Fort Valley plant

Blue Bird said it continues to face supply chain disruptions due to the war in Ukraine and the lingering pandemic.

Buses at Blue Bird CorporationFORT VALLEY, Georgia (41NBC/WMGT)—Blue Bird Corporation, the school bus manufacturer in Fort Valley, recently laid off more than 100 people. In statement sent to 41NBC, Blue Bird said it continues to face supply chain disruptions due to the war in Ukraine and the lingering pandemic. In total, 115 production workers were affected.
